Transaction 81a666c343c0236f6eb4eb828f6f950b3042316a162711301ad3426d202cb624
1 Input
1 Output
-
81a666c343c0236f6eb4eb828f6f950b3042316a162711301ad3426d202cb624:0
- value
- 7999999694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f966ad2c0d458e0924b7e1918a2c5b54e00dfc9f OP_EQUAL
- address
- 3QRjBPqdDcvNFtLhqzAM2PeSXAKNH2SWU7